Hola-
I'm heading back to Moab for my yearly "Man-Vacation" this weekend, and am wondering if anyone has ridden the entire length of Gold Bar Rim-Golden Spike-Poison Spider Mesa. I know that some of those trails can have obstacles that just aren't possible on atv's. The Golden Crack turned me around 2 years ago, but I've been told you can get around it if you approach it in a different area. A buddy and I are thinking about trying all three trails in a day, from North to South, then either turn around and go back, or go into Moab if it's too late.
I've done Gold Bar Rim a number of times and don't consider any of that trail to be beyond my skills. I've done Golden Spike from Gold Bar Rim to Golden Crack, and that is doable as well for me. I'm most concerned about running into a very steep slickrock incline, that if I were to flip, there would be nothing to stop me or my SP500 from rolling right off some cliff. I'f I get myself killed, the Mrs might not let me come back next year! [img]i/expressions/face-icon-small-wink.gif[/img]
If anyone has any firsthand knowledge of Poison Spider Mesa or Golden Spike, I'd love to hear from you before Saturday, May 4, 2002. Thanks!

I rode all of those trails last week on a KTM250 two wheel. I would be woried about the same points you mentioned. We did see a guy running Cain Creek on a 4WD Polaris. He did fine (in most spots). The difference with Cain Creek is that it is in the canyon (not on top of the big rocks). The views are still awesome. If you are in the area, I would highly recommend Factory Butte /SwingArm City - very nice loamy hill climbs.

On the back side of Poison Spider, I don't think there is anything you can't get through. On the mountain bike we ride up the back side, then down the front along the cliff. The cliff side is single track, and near suicide even on a mountain bike, so the ATV won't go there. Can't remember much about the other rides (it's been a few years). 2nd day Poison Spider Mesa

First let me say this is a great trail for ATV's very hard at times. After a big breakfast at Mickydees we headed out to the trail head, as we unloaded the Atv's there were some peddle bike riders getting ready to go, they gave us some mean looks one of there dogs even came over to Fred and was trying to bite him they just sat there he was about to kick it when it finely left. on the trail now first thing we came to was the Launching Pad, this was very steep and keep your tires spinning we all made it, the wedgie was next it was fun got some good Pic and video of us going threw it, I'll tell you their are some spots that will beet the best riders on this trail, if you are scarred of heights this is not a good ride for you, in fact most of Moad has high spots that can make you grip the seat of your bike with out using your hands, at Buck's Hill we had our 3rd roll over, luck was on Alan's side he landed in a depression filled with sand and the bike rolled over the top of him only scuffing the elbows, the Honda stared right backup and we keep going, next was Sky Line Dr. not for the faint of hart almost straight up and straight down no room for a mistake, I don't think you could walk this without using your hands and sliding, scared the he!! out of me when I seen the bike ahead of me going down on only his front wheels, I felt the back-end of my bike come up a couple of times, gets your hart going. their are many places with out names along this trail that get your attention a couple of 3 and 4 foot drop's that you will need help. The Golden Crack, I was told that no ATV could get threw this with out a lot of help Dave went first and when you look a the Pic you will see he needed a lot of help, Then me I did it with only one person helping. no one else want to try it so we grabbed a big log and put it in the crack so everyone could get across. Me and Dave did it without the log Polaris and Arctic Cat. this is were we ate lunch the view was incredible I can't describe it, next we went to the Dbl Whammy it was getting late so we decided to head back, we did remove the log. on the way back we ran into some Jeeps coming across the trail so we stopped and watched them go down a real hard spot the look on some of there faces was priceless when they seen what they had to do pure tearer. Tip for you remove the bumper before you do this trail or it will... not much happened on the way back some drag races in the sand and side hill climbs all and all a great ride but only if you are well prepared and have lots of experience
